The etymology of the word "Sauna" is uncertain. That hasn't bothered the millions who enjoy the virtues of the hot (and sometimes very hot) air. Particularly popular in the Nordic countries, it has been exported to the rest of Europe, North America and Russia.

The temperature can reach 80° or even higher in the dry sauna, while being still bearable. In the humid hammam however the temperature is only 40°, since the humidity would scald at a higher temperature.
